Running CCL only requires the kernel and the full-image (and tools/asdf.lisp if you want) I think you can upload a binary package like 'ccl-bootstrap' and build the real 'ccl' package using it. Then use 'ccl' to build the next version directly. This would implement self-hosting. NOTE, no need to put the compiled kernel and image file in the source package.
